vlookup函数失败
以vlookup函数失败为题,我们来探讨一下在使用vlookup函数时可能出现的问题以及如何避免这些问题。
vlookup函数是Excel中非常常用的一种函数,它用于在一个数据表中根据给定的值,查并返回相应的数据。然而,尽管这个函数非常强大,但在实际使用中,我们经常会遇到一些问题,导致vlookup函数无法正常工作。
vlookup函数8种用法一个常见的问题是数据类型不匹配。vlookup函数在查数据时,要求查值和数据表中的值类型一致,否则就无法到对应的结果。如果查值是一个数字,而数据表中的值是文本,那么vlookup函数就会返回错误。为了避免这个问题,我们需要确保查值和数据表中的值类型一致,或者在使用vlookup函数之前,将数据表中的值转换成与查值类型一致。
另一个常见的问题是范围不正确。vlookup函数在查数据时,需要指定一个范围,这个范围包括要查的值以及要返回的结果。如果范围不正确,就会导致vlookup函数无法到对应的结果。为了避免这个问题,我们需要确保范围正确,包括正确指定查值所在的列和数据表中包含查值和结果的区域。
一个容易被忽视的问题是数据表中是否有重复值。vlookup函数在查数据时,只会返回到的第一个匹配结果,如果数据表中有重复值,那么vlookup函数可能会返回错误的结果。为了避免这个问题,我们需要确保数据表中没有重复值,或者使用其他函数(如index和match函数)来替代vlookup函数。
另外一个问题是vlookup函数无法处理模糊匹配。vlookup函数只能进行精确匹配,如果查值与数据表中的值相似但不完全相同,那么vlookup函数就无法到对应的结果。为了解决这个问题,我们可以使用其他函数,如index和match函数,来进行模糊匹配。
一个常见的问题是数据表的结构发生变化。如果数据表的结构发生变化,例如插入或删除了列,那么vlookup函数的范围可能会发生变化,导致函数无法正常工作。为了避免这个问题,我们需要在使用vlookup函数之前,确保数据表的结构稳定,或者在使用函数时,使用动态范围来适应数据表的变化。
尽管vlookup函数非常强大,但在使用时也会遇到一些问题。为了避免这些问题,我们需要注意数据类型的匹配、范围的正确性、数据表中是否有重复值、是否需要模糊匹配以及数据表的结构稳定性等方面的问题。只有充分理解和注意这些问题,我们才能正确地使用vlo
okup函数,并获得准确的结果。
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。
发表评论